Program Description:
Provides supportive services, including housing, for homeless adults ages 18-21. The program is designed to enable young adults who are homeless to obtain and remain in permanent housing, increase their personal skills and/or income, and achieve greater independence. Two-year program. Operated by Volunteers of America Texas.
Eligibility: Homeless youth aged 18-21. Participants must be working, actively searching for employment, or be enrolled in school.
Services offered:
Assessment
Housing (assistance with rent and utilities)
Transportation
Accessing benefits
Job training
Job seeking
Assistance with continuing education (GED, college, vocational training, etc.)
Life skills training
Individual counseling
Substance abuse treatment
Emergency assistance for food and personal hygiene
